概括
2023年带来了重要的心脏病学更新,包括欧洲心脏病学会 (ESC) 对急性冠状动脉综合征 (ACS),内心炎,心力衰竭和心血管预防的新指南. 这篇综述强调了心脏护理领域的关键进展.

Adrenergic Antagonists: ɑ and β-Receptor Blockers
449
Third-generation β-blockers, such as labetalol and carvedilol, represent a significant advancement in managing cardiovascular conditions. Unlike conventional β-blockers, which can induce peripheral vasoconstriction, third-generation drugs block α1 adrenoceptors. This promotes vasodilation through several mechanisms, such as increased nitric oxide production, inhibition of calcium ion entry, opening of potassium ion channels, and antioxidant action.
